From Italy to Patras

There are many connections across the Adriatic Sea and a few ferry companies operate between the Italian ports of Brindisi and Ancona and the port of Patras.

If you have your own car take the road to Korinthos and then on to Athens (220 km). Be extremely careful as this poor excuse for a national road is very dangerous and accidents happen very often.

If you're travelling without a car take the intercity bus (KTEL) to Athens central station which costs €18.90.

From the islands to Piraeus

If you arrive in Piraeus on a boat, chances are that you'll disembark within walking distance of the metro terminal. If you are too far (such as the cruise liner dock) or your luggage is too heavy there is a free bus service that runs inside the harbour. Try to avoid taxis in the port: it you do need one, then pick one up from off the street outside the harbour area.
